Leviticus 26:32

And I will bring the land into desolation: and your enemies which dwell therein shall be astonished at it.

KJV

Disperdamque terram vestram, et stupebunt super ea inimici vestri, cum habitatores illius fuerint.

Vulgate

καὶ ἐξερημώσω ἐγὼ τὴν γῆν ὑμῶν, καὶ θαυμάσονται ἐπ’ αὐτῇ οἱ ἐχθροὶ ὑμῶν οἱ ἐνοικοῦντες ἐν αὐτῇ·

LXX

And I will bring the land into desolation; and your enemies that dwell therein shall be astonished at it.

ASV

וַ/הֲשִׁמֹּתִ֥י אֲנִ֖י אֶת הָ/אָ֑רֶץ וְ/שָֽׁמְמ֤וּ עָלֶ֨י/הָ֙ אֹֽיְבֵי/כֶ֔ם הַ/יֹּשְׁבִ֖ים בָּֽ/הּ

Hebrew

Cross-references

  • 1Kgs 9:8 — And at this house, which is high, every one that passeth by it shall be astonished, and shall hiss; and they shall say, Why hath the LORD done thus unto this land, and to this house?
  • 2Chr 29:8 — Wherefore the wrath of the LORD was upon Judah and Jerusalem, and he hath delivered them to trouble, to astonishment, and to hissing, as ye see with your eyes.
  • 2Kgs 17:6 — In the ninth year of Hoshea the king of Assyria took Samaria, and carried Israel away into Assyria, and placed them in Halah and in Habor by the river of Gozan, and in the cities of the Medes.
  • Deut 28:37 — And thou shalt become an astonishment, a proverb, and a byword, among all nations whither the LORD shall lead thee.
  • Ezek 5:15 — So it shall be a reproach and a taunt, an instruction and an astonishment unto the nations that are round about thee, when I shall execute judgments in thee in anger and in fury and in furious rebukes
  • Jer 9:11 — And I will make Jerusalem heaps, and a den of dragons; and I will make the cities of Judah desolate, without an inhabitant.
  • Jer 18:16 — To make their land desolate, and a perpetual hissing; every one that passeth thereby shall be astonished, and wag his head.
  • Jer 19:8 — And I will make this city desolate, and an hissing; every one that passeth thereby shall be astonished and hiss because of all the plagues thereof.
  • Jer 25:11 — And this whole land shall be a desolation, and an astonishment; and these nations shall serve the king of Babylon seventy years.
  • Jer 25:18 — To wit, Jerusalem, and the cities of Judah, and the kings thereof, and the princes thereof, to make them a desolation, an astonishment, an hissing, and a curse; as it is this day;
